Output 8a8e1b763b571aa7695e1367859ead63d30620e7fb2fa68232294cb78223c170:186

value
58555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7b39ff9f8beab505d78ecf574f92c557c64dbf8 OP_EQUAL
address
3QGk1UyzSwXQrpd1GBX8ZAao5AAfUmKYKv
transaction
8a8e1b763b571aa7695e1367859ead63d30620e7fb2fa68232294cb78223c170
confirmations
150942
spent
true